Summary:Artificial intelligence (AI) is one of the method that human use to communicate between human and computer. There are a lot of applications has been produces by AI approach such as medical diagnosis, proving mathematical theorems and autonomous vehicle. Many methods and approach has been used by researcher to develop speech recognition system such as neural network and Hidden Markov Model. This research aim is to develop a isolated Malay speech recognition using Fuzzy Logic method. This research is focused on six isolated words which is empat (four), lapan (eight), rekod (record), tidak (no), tujuh (seven), and tutup (close). This research is also focused on the development of fuzzy rules between each words. The evaluation process is measured based on the accuracy rate between the previous method using Hidden Markov Model. The result show that 75% speech recognition accuracy rate using fuzzy logic method.
